¼ Groat from County of Holland. Issued from 1429 to 1431. Struck in Billon. Measures 0 mm and weighs 0.8 g.
- Obverse
- Burgundian shield (Philip, Duke of Burgundy and Regent of Zeeland and Holland)
- Reverse
- Long cross pattee intersecting legend, over a shield of Bavaria-Holland. (Jacqueline, Duchess of Bavaria and Countess (of Holland))
